PC Video & Audio Input The MA2F chassis models (KDL-40SL140 and KDL-46SL140) have a Personal Computer Input (PC-IN), which connects directly to the PC 15 pin DIN connector (HD15 connector). Once connected the TV functions as a video monitor and audio output (separate Stereo Mini Plug) for the PC.

    Chassis PCB Layout LCD Panel Assembly The LCD Panel Assembly includes the LCD Panel, TCON, and Backlight Lamps. The LCD Panel contains the actual liquid crystals, color fi lters, and polarizers. The liquid crystals are manipulated by the applied voltage to pass a specifi...
